FUMC Chancel Choir to present Easter concert
      The Chancel Choir of the First United Methodist Church will sing its annual Easter concert at the Salitpa United Methodist Church on Sunday, March 16 at 3 p.m. The church no longer has weekly worship services, but opens its doors for the choir to present an Easter performance yearly.

Bryant graduates from basic training
      Air Force Reserve Airman 1st Class Lexander V. Bryant has graduated from basic military training at Lackland Air Force Base, San Antonio, Texas.

Cooking and entertaining is focus of Woman's Club meeting
      The Woman's Club met March 4 at the home of Diane McCorquodale. Each member brought an appetizer for the occasion with the hostesses providing the heavier appetizer, desserts and drinks. Molly Parham presented the program on the art of cooking and how entertaining has changed over the years.
